Is WhatsApp safe for privacy?
WhatsApp’s recent move to scan messages directly on your device for scam detection introduces a new layer of surveillance, despite claims of privacy preservation. While message content remains end-to-end encrypted in transit, the processing of your data locally still provides valuable behavioral and pattern insights to Meta, quietly extending their reach into your private digital space.
You believe your conversations are yours. End-to-end encryption promises that. It means only you and your recipient can read what is sent. This is true for WhatsApp message content. The words themselves are shielded between devices. But privacy is a spectrum, not a binary.
Now, WhatsApp employs Machine Learning directly on your phone. This algorithm sifts through your messages. It searches for patterns, for indicators of a scam. They say the content stays on your device. It is not uploaded to their servers. This is the 'privacy-preserving' part. It sounds comforting. It is not the full truth.
Think of it this way: your device becomes an extension of Meta’s security apparatus. It processes your data. It generates insights. These insights, even if anonymized or aggregated, are then transmitted back. What is a scam? How often do they occur? What keywords or phrases are common? This data helps Meta refine its models, police its platform. It helps them understand you better, without ever directly 'reading' your messages in plain text. Your personal device is now a quiet informant, working for the platform, analysing your digital life. This is a subtle, unsettling shift.

What about true privacy? What about messages that genuinely leave no trace? Some platforms offer self-destructing messages, where conversations vanish after a set time. They avoid collecting metadata, the silent trail of who spoke to whom, when, and for how long. They are built to forget. WhatsApp, for all its default end-to-end encryption, collects vast amounts of metadata. It backs up your chats to external cloud services like Google Drive or iCloud, often without default encryption for those backups. Your past lives on, outside the app’s control, but within easy reach of others. Signal, for instance, offers strong end-to-end encryption and collects minimal metadata, making it a stronger contender for true privacy. But even Signal cannot prevent on-device processing if it chooses to implement similar local scanning features without extreme transparency and user control.
